摘要
In this paper, new symmetry reductions and similarity solutions for Burgers equation with moving boundary are obtained by means of Lie's method of infinitesimal transformation groups, for a linearly moving boundary as well as a parabolically moving boundary. By using discrete symmetries, new analytical solutions for the problem under consideration are presented, for two cases of the moving boundary: one moving with constant velocity and another one rapidly oscillating.
